Job Summary
We’re hiring an Aircraft Maintenance Technician (AMT) for full‑time helicopter maintenance at Reach Air Medical Services in McClellan, CA. The role supports H125, H130, H135, EC145 airframes, ensuring safety and timely service delivery.
Compensation- Starting Salary: $73,554–$107,281 annually (including 15% geographic modifier)
- IA Stipend: $2,080
- Sign‑On Bonus: $12,500
- Perform mechanical inspections, screening, repairs and provide regular status updates to the Lead Technician.
- Manage inventory checks, keep the equipment tracking log up to date and place replacement requests as necessary.
- Document service paperwork and FAA information as required, adhering to company policies and information security standards.
- Maintain a safe and clean working environment for the aircraft maintenance team and flight crew.
- Coordinate communication efforts between departments, vendors and team members.
- Work professionally with allied health, public safety personnel and fellow AMTs and operations staff.
Required Qualifications
- Three (3) years turbine‑powered helicopter experience.
- Valid Airframe and Powerplant (A&P) license.
- Valid State‑issued Driver’s license.
- High School diploma or GED equivalent.
- Federal Aviation Regulations knowledge.
- EMS systems, aircraft maintenance systems, records and maintenance support and planning experience.
- Ability to work a flexible schedule, including overtime and 24/7 on‑call rotations.
- Acceptable in accordance with the FAA drug and alcohol testing program.
- Push and/or pull 100+ lbs.
- Lift and/or carry up to 50 lbs.
- AS350, EC130, EC135, EC145 maintenance experience.
- FAA Inspection Authorization Certificate.
- Related experience under CFR Parts 91, 135 and 145. li>Autopilot maintenance experience.
- Avionics and electrical repair experience.
